Getting Started – Registration and Verification
First‑time visitors to Neds will find the sign‑up process intentionally straightforward. You begin by entering a valid email address, choosing a password and confirming your date of birth – all standard fields that help the site stay compliant with Australian gambling regulations.
After you hit “Register”, a verification email lands in your inbox. Clicking the link completes the account creation, but you’ll soon be prompted for a KYC (Know Your Customer) check. Upload a clear scan of your driver’s licence or passport and a recent utility bill; the upload window accepts JPG, PNG and PDF files up to 5 MB. Verification usually clears within a few minutes, though busy periods can stretch it to an hour.

Security, Licensing and Responsible Gambling
Neds operates under a licence from the Northern Territory Racing Commission, which is recognised by the Australian Communications and Media Authority. All data transfers are encrypted with 128‑bit SSL, and the site undergoes regular third‑party audits to confirm fairness of its RNG‑based games.
For players who want to keep their gambling in check, the platform includes self‑exclusion tools, deposit limits and a “cool‑off” period that can be set from 24 hours up to six months. If you ever feel you need extra help, the site links directly to Australian gambling support services such as Gambling Help Online.
